What Are Threshold Levels?

So, just what are these threshold levels we're talking about? Think of them as a tipping point. It's that moment when the damage caused by pests could start to outweigh the cost of controlling them. Imagine spending a small fortune protecting your crops from a pest that isn’t doing much harm—now that doesn’t make sense, does it? But if those pesky critters suddenly explode in number and threaten to ruin your entire harvest, then it’s game on.

The Big Picture in Pest Management

You might be wondering—Isn’t pesticide use sometimes necessary? Absolutely, and that’s where understanding those thresholds becomes even more critical. The philosophy behind IPM isn’t to eliminate all pests at any cost; it’s about managing populations responsibly and knowing when intervention is genuinely required.

Integrating various strategies—from biological controls like beneficial insects and natural pesticides to cultural practices like crop rotation—allows for a multi-pronged approach that doesn’t always rely on chemicals. Think of it as building a robust defense system. By using a suite of tools, you position yourself to tackle pest issues head-on without wreaking havoc on your crop’s natural allies.
